GameFi Tokens are essentially cryptocurrencies that are integral to the gameplay within decentralized games. These tokens can be earned through various in-game activities such as completing quests, defeating opponents, or trading virtual assets. The value of these tokens is often tied to the game's popularity and the underlying blockchain network's performance. As a result, players not only enjoy the thrill of gaming but also have the opportunity to accumulate digital assets that can be traded on cryptocurrency exchanges for real-world value.
One of the key advantages of GameFi Tokens is their ability to foster a sense of community and ownership among players. Unlike traditional games where developers retain full control, GameFi platforms often adopt decentralized governance models. This means that token holders can participate in decision-making processes, influencing the direction and evolution of the game. Such democratization empowers players and creates a more inclusive and collaborative gaming environment.
Moreover, GameFi Tokens introduce a new dimension of economic activity within games. Players can engage in complex financial strategies, such as staking tokens to earn interest, providing liquidity to decentralized exchanges, or even launching their own in-game businesses. This blend of gaming and finance opens up endless possibilities for innovation and monetization, attracting both gamers and investors alike.
However, the rise of GameFi Tokens also poses challenges. The volatility of cryptocurrency markets can lead to significant fluctuations in token value, potentially impacting players' earnings. Additionally, the regulatory landscape surrounding blockchain and cryptocurrencies remains uncertain, which could affect the long-term sustainability of GameFi platforms.
